Introduction: In computer science a "visualization" is a reference to a number of different techniques that are
used for creating images, diagrams, or animations to communicate a message. The purpose of
visualization is to make clear (illuminate) patterns in the data that might otherwise go
unnoticed. Don't confuse visualizations with simulations! A visualization does NOT generate any
new data.

Types of Visualizations: You can use Many Eyes to create a variety of different types of visualizations.
1. Click on the "Visualization types" link in the "Learn More" section.
a. b. The following types of visualizations are available:
i. Network Diagrams, Scatter-plots and Matrix Charts
To help show relationships among data points
ii. Bar Charts, Block Histograms and Bubble Charts
To help you compare a set of values
iii. Line Graphs and Stack Graphs
To help you track rises and falls over time
iv. Pie Charts and Treemaps
To help you see the parts of a whole
v. Word Trees, Tag Clouds and Phrase Nets
To help you analyze text
vi. Geographic Maps
To help you overlay data values on a map of a geographic region (e.g., a
country)
